Post Tsumabuki plays teacher in semi-documentary

Satoshi Tsumabuki will be starring in a semi-documentary film, currently titled "Buta ga Ita Kyoushitsu." This is his first role as a teacher.

The movie is based on the true story of a class of sixth graders at an elementary school in Osaka. A rookie teacher suggested an educational project that involved the class raising a pig so that they could later eat it. The project naturally led to differences of opinions among the students.

The story was turned into an award-winning TV documentary in 1993. The film version will also be shot in the style of a documentary. A class of 28 children, chosen by audition, will actually live with and raise a pig. While the general plot will follow the real-life story, there is no detailed script - producer Toshiaki Suzuki hopes to capture the true reactions of the children.

The movie is scheduled for theatrical release next fall.
